Pound Sign

New York City, pop culture, art and nightlife. Because nobody else is blogging about those things.

Tuesday, August 15, 2006

You know, I didn't like this movie the first time I saw it. I don't know what I was thinking either.

Courtesy of Last Stop: This Town.

And you know, that isn't even the funniest Big L clip out there. This is.


Post a Comment

<< Home